Book Now: Quality Inn East

  • Home
    Properties:
  • >
  • World
    5,611,537
  • >
  • United States Hotels
    455,955
  • >
  • Texas State Hotels
    24,717
  • >
  • Amarillo (TX) Hotels
    130
  • >
  • Quality Inn East